                    CALIFORNIA LEGISLATURE 20212022 REGULAR SESSION Assembly Bill No. 2466Introduced by Assembly Member CervantesFebruary 17, 2022 An act relating to public social services. LEGISLATIVE COUNSEL'S DIGESTAB 2466, as introduced, Cervantes. Foster care and adoption.Existing law provides for the implementation of the resource family approval process, which replaces the multiple processes for licensing foster family homes, certifying foster homes by foster family agencies, approving relatives and nonrelative extended family members as foster care providers, and approving guardians and adoptive families. This bill would state the intent of the Legislature to enact legislation to address the challenges and barriers in the adoption and foster care process for LGBTQ+ families.Digest Key Vote: MAJORITY  Appropriation: NO  Fiscal Committee: NO  Local Program: NO Bill TextThe people of the State of California do enact as follows:SECTION 1. It is the intent of the Legislature to enact legislation to address the challenges and barriers in the adoption and foster care process for LGBTQ+ families.
